Enjoy games galore at the Southern-Fried Gaming Expo
This weekend, the Southern-Fried Gaming Expo will bring together thousands of gaming fans across two locations for a celebration of all things gaming-related. Attendees can expect tons of great programming and special appearances by various guests including, Tim Kitzrow (the iconic voice of NBA Jam) and ZapCristal (better known as Zap on YouTube).

Get down with jazz Friday night at The High
This Friday, head to the High Museum for a night of live jazz featuring Sabor! Brass Band and KT Collaborative. Enjoy light food fare and drinks while exploring the museum or taking part in a docent tour and learning more about the works on view.

Support an Atlanta-based artist
On Saturday at Ambient+Studio, artist Amber Nicole will present her first solo exhibition, “My Hair Speaks Volumes.” Amber Nicole creates 3D artwork as an artistic representation of the beauty in Black women’s natural hair using records, flowers and crystals.

See behind the scenes of Tiny Doors ATL
Meet Tiny Doors ATL artist Karen Anderson Singer and check out her studio on the third Saturday of every month from 10 a.m. to 3 p.m. See works in progress, shop exclusive Tiny Doors merch and view the retired door gallery!
